Bianca is a modern American restaurant and bar in Chestnut Hill that specializes in wood grilling, wood fire pizza, and a variety of dishes inspired by global flavors and cuisines. Bianca means a clean slate, a virtual white plate primed for delicious expression and ready to transport you to far off places. From classic dishes done with care to the truly unique, Bianca presents a luxe dining experience in a relaxed atmosphere that is as comfortable as our own homes. Owners Chef Tim Cushman and Restaurateur Nancy Cushman are the husband & wife team behind James Beard Award Winning o ya and Hojoko in Boston.

    It was our first visit and we were excited to try a new place... our food and service was not great. We ordered the wood grilled cauliflower appetizer and the spinach & artichoke appetizer, then for mains a Caesar Salad and Freebird Wood Rotisserie Half Chicken with a side of french fries. A half hour after placing our order the main Chicken entree arrived, with no french fries, a few minutes after that the Grilled Cauliflower appetizer came out, we had to flag down our waitress to ask for the french fries, to simply eat them with the main. The Artichoke appetizer arrived out, barley warm long after the chicken dinner. Finally after my husband was more or less done with his rotisserie chicken dinner the french fries came out. After we were done with the food that did come out, over an hour after placing our order I requested to cancel the Caeser Salad order because I was not going to simply eat my main alone when my husband was done with his. Shortly before asking for our check the Caeser salad arrived to which we declined, they offered it to us to go but we left it for the waitress. The food was ok, service was not great, no one checking in on how the food was never mind the complete lack of proper timing of what we ordered. Its a shame, maybe just an off night.

    Ate at Bianca's before a Boston College hockey game. The space is open and energetic, and we were sat right on time with our reservation. The staff were friendly and welcoming. We ordered cocktails, which were well prepared. I had an old fashioned, and it came out relatively quickly and tasted great. We also ordered some appetizers and pizzas to share. The tuna tartare was amazing. It had a sauce that was somewhat acidic and paired really welly with the fish. We also had a fried chicken appetizer which had a really light and crisp breading that was well seasoned. It was not oily at all. To share, we got two pizzas which are cooked in wood stove with a chewy crust. The sauce, cheese, and toppings were all fantastic and, again, very high quality meal. Overally, I had zero complaints. The staff kept checking in on us on a regular basis, the drinks were great, we never felt rushed, and had a great experience.
